🛒 Ingredients
-
16 oz whole button or cremini mushrooms, cleaned and stems trimmed
-
1 cup all-purpose flour
-
2 large eggs
-
1 cup milk or buttermilk
-
1½ cups seasoned breadcrumbs or panko
-
½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
-
1 tsp garlic powder
-
1 tsp onion powder
-
½ tsp paprika
-
Salt & black pepper, to taste
-
Oil for frying
👩🍳 Instructions
-
In one bowl, whisk eggs and milk.
-
In another bowl, mix breadcrumbs, Parmesan,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, salt, and pepper.
-
Dredge mushrooms in flour, then dip into egg mixture, then coat with breadcrumb mixture.
-
Heat oil in a deep skillet to 350°F (175°C).
-
Fry mushrooms in batches for 2–3 minutes, until golden brown.
-
Drain on paper towels and serve hot.
🧊 Storage & Reheating
-
Best eaten fresh.
-
Reheat in air fryer or oven to restore crispiness.
